**Onboarding: Feedwarden release duties**

Feedwarden validates podcast RSS feeds before they hit the Castellane distribution tier. Releases cut Tuesdays. Your responsibilities: tag the build, run the validator regression suite, unseal the signing vault, sign artifacts, publish. The vault seals automatically after each release. Unsealing requires the release-manager recovery passphrase, kept on record for continuity. For this handover, it is noted immediately below.

unlock words, fafop-hawep: briwyn-oliix-sorox

## Account Recovery — Trailnote Offline Mode

When a surveyor's Trailnote app has been offline for 30+ days, their local credentials expire and sync refuses to resume. Don't make them wipe the device — all their unsynced field data lives there! Instead, open the support console, pick "Offline Reinstate," and enter their handle. The console will ask for the support team's shared recovery passphrase before issuing a reinstatement token. Use the one below.

unlock words, bagaf-fajeg: zorael-kelax-fraath-quenix-eliok-sileth-aldmir-wenir-druiel

Hi Brightmoor integration team,

Quick summary before the weekly eng sync: our Heronpost notification service now applies adaptive backpressure when fan-out queues exceed 50k pending deliveries. Instead of dropping events, we shed to a deferred lane and replay within ten minutes. Your webhooks may see short bursts of delayed delivery; ordering per recipient is preserved.

Please validate against our sandbox before Thursday. You can authenticate your test calls with the bearer token below.

login token, bagug-kafop: eyJhbGciOiJIUzI1NiIsInR5cCI6IkpXVCJ9.eyJzdWIiOiIcMLov2In0.Z5RLDIfp

## Environment Variables

The Lanewise address autocomplete widget reads its configuration at build time. Releases must set `LANEWISE_REGION=harmouth-1` and `LANEWISE_DEBOUNCE_MS=150` in the release env file; the widget refuses to render without both. Suggestions are served from the Corvath geocoding tier, which requires authentication on every request. Before tagging the release, append the geocoder credential on the line immediately after the region setting:

vault entry, yahif-yajep: COURIER_KEY29=b802bdf8034096b65a51c6ba5abe2